About Douglas

Douglas Horngrad practices criminal law in San Francisco, California. He is the owner of the Law Offices of Douglas Horngrad and Sam O'Keefe, a firm he established in 1989. The office handles a variety of cases, including DUI and DWI offenses, domestic violence, and white-collar crime. His experience in the field allows him to navigate complex legal issues effectively, ensuring that his clients receive comprehensive representation. He earned his Juris Doctor from Golden Gate University School of Law in 1980. Prior to that, he completed his Bachelor of Arts at Suffolk University in 1973.
